Output 3f4e8567f7cc91b88db71e4e228e3792d8a5ed0ab92c94fa84d1dca724cbcd79:0

value
677505
script pubkey
OP_0 OP_PUSHBYTES_20 291e42fb18ea046a55de43b02553ed364c1a00b4
address
bc1q9y0y97ccagzx54w7gwcz25ldxexp5q9550l5zj
transaction
3f4e8567f7cc91b88db71e4e228e3792d8a5ed0ab92c94fa84d1dca724cbcd79
confirmations
185989
spent
true